The transcript discusses the challenges and implications of the Brexit negotiations, focusing on the aggressive timeframe set by Theresa May. It highlights concerns about the UK's ability to trigger negotiations and the impact on the British pound and investment strategies. The discussion also covers the uncertainty in foreign investment flows and the need for clarity in the government's stance to ensure long-term investment in the UK.
